Output 8d158bb1592a730c6495885105ab88fdcdf622a4ae82211e37fc904afd56ec3f:0

value
9413418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5224166b8b6bf08ae0d4d2c158a1714af4d70940 OP_EQUAL
address
39BLZgZ4NzL7gNjkkQ63Rz3Y3ZSQQJMayA
transaction
8d158bb1592a730c6495885105ab88fdcdf622a4ae82211e37fc904afd56ec3f
spent
true